ANECDOTE

Pandemic Simulations

  • Jane McGonigal ran pandemic simulations in 2008 and 2010, involving thousands of participants.
  • These simulations eerily predicted aspects of the 2020 COVID-19 pandemic, including social distancing and misinformation.
INSIGHT

Social Simulations

  • Social simulations prioritize social and emotional intelligence over algorithms.
  • They gather data by asking people how they would react in hypothetical future scenarios.
